2039.3 | Make your own | CALVA::WOLINSKI | uCoder sans Frontieres | Tue Oct 17 1989 10:45 | 19 |
Rep .0 Why not make your own??? I make a similar thing for an apple tart with almonds. Try the following, Take 1 cup of "raw" hazelnuts and soak them in boiling water for about two minutes and drain. The skin will come right off in your fingers by just rubbing them. Place the nuts in a blender or processor <I like the blender better> add 2 TBLS of butter or margarine, and 2 TBLS of either vanilla, rum, cognac, bourbon, calvados, ... and process until a fine paste. I would think if you need a thick paste just omit the liquid. If you need a sweet paste just add sugar to taste. This should yield about 2/3 Cup of paste. Bon Chance, -mike | |||||
2039.4 | superfine sugar will prevent grain | THE780::WILDE | Ask yourself..am I a happy cow? | Tue Oct 17 1989 14:53 | 3 |
Additional thought on making your own paste. Use superfine sugar (bar sugar or castor sugar to some of us) to sweeten the paste and you will not get a grainy product. |
